Java框架之spring—jdbcTemplate

Posted 小猫钓鱼吃鱼

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Java框架之spring—jdbcTemplate相关的知识,希望对你有一定的参考价值。

JdbcTemplate

今天我们利用 springIOC 写一个 JdbcTemplate 来实现一个表的简单的增删改查

步骤如下:

首先创建数据库,创建一个学生表 student (id,name,age);

技术图片
技术图片

写服务层的接口和实现类以及dao层的接口和实现类

 

学生实体类

技术图片

服务类的接口

技术图片

服务类接口的实现类

技术图片

dao接口

技术图片

 

dao的实现类

技术图片

利用 springIOC 实现服务类和 Dao 类的依赖

技术图片

注册类似于 DbUtil 的管理数据库连接的类

引入jar包

spring-jdbc-4.2.1.RELEASE.jar

spring-tx-4.2.1.RELEASE.jar

技术图片

oracle和mysql的驱动包 .

mysql-connector-java-5.0.8-bin.jar

ojdbc14.jar

技术图片

注册数据源

注入数据库四要素

技术图片

注册jdbctemplate,依赖于datasource

技术图片

 

描述dao类与jdbcTemplate的依赖关系

 

技术图片

学生表的增删改查操作

技术图片
技术图片

现在我们来测试代码的逻辑!

首先是增

技术图片

查看一下数据库

技术图片

证明我们的逻辑走通了!

再测试一下删

添加两行数据

技术图片

有两行的数据一样,我们删掉一个!就删掉id=2的这一条。

技术图片

查看一下结果

技术图片

技术图片

查看数据库结果

技术图片

技术图片

 

以上是关于Java框架之spring—jdbcTemplate的主要内容,如果未能解决你的问题,请参考以下文章

Spring框架之使用JdbcTemplate开发Dao层程序

Spring框架针对dao层的jdbcTemplate操作crud之delete删除数据库操作 Spring相关Jar包下载

Spring框架针对dao层的jdbcTemplate操作crud之add添加数据库操作

Java之Spring JdbcTemplate(一篇文章精通系列)

Java之Spring JdbcTemplate(一篇文章精通系列)

spring之jdbcTemplate